Abstract

The invention discloses an automobile DVD screen anti-glare checking method. By means of the principle of reversibility of light of geometrical optics, a driver eye ellipse serves as the collection of numerous point light sources, the light sources emit to a DVD screen and turn into reflection light beams through reflection, and the region where the reflection light beams emit is observed; if partial or all of the reflection light beams penetrate the automobile window transparent region to emit outside the automobile, the glare of the DVD screen is produced; if not, the glare of the DVD screen is not produced, and the DVD screen anti-glare checking is completed. The method is simple and effective, the checking data is more complete, the checking result is more reliable, and the method is adaptive to large-scale promotion and application.

Background technology
Automobile DVD day by day popularizes as the important configuration of vehicle-mounted video and music entertainment system, if but the position of DVD screen and angle are arranged unreasonable, from the high light directive DVD screen of outside, likely inject driver's eyes after reflection, chaufeur is produced dazzling, affect traffic safety.
When using Three-dimensional CAD Software (as CATIA, UG NX etc.) to carry out vehicle complete vehicle design, the layout of DVD screen is except considering that the visuality of screen, DVD screen are with except the reasonable clearance of its Surrounding Parts, also must carry out calibration assessment to the anti-glare situation of DVD screen.
When carrying out the anti-glare check of DVD screen, usual way chooses extraneous possible light directive DVD screen, checks reflected light rays and whether enter Driver's eyellipse, if reflected light rays enters eyellipse, then think that DVD screen can produce dazzling; If reflected light rays does not enter eyellipse, then think that DVD screen can not produce dazzling.
The defect of above check method is, extraneous light may through the transmission region directive DVD screen of any one piece of vehicle glass, incident ray position and direction all have uncertainty, only choose the anti-glare check that some incident raies carry out DVD screen, obviously sufficiently complete; And method of exhaustion will be adopted to consider all possible situation, be obviously also unpractical.
Summary of the invention
The present invention is directed to the defect of the anti-glare check method of above DVD screen, according to light path principle of reversibility, propose the anti-glare check method of a kind of automobile DVD screen, the anti-glare check of DVD screen completed thus is more complete, and conclusion has more confidence level.
Technical scheme of the present invention is as follows:
The anti-glare check method of a kind of automobile DVD screen, comprises the following steps:
(1) the preliminary layout of DVD screen is carried out in the position provided according to the moulding of interior trim instrument carrier panel, and described layout should meet chaufeur visual requirement and peripheral clearance requirement;
(2) according to car load operator's compartment human engineering deployment scenarios and chaufeur human body sitting posture, draw Driver's eyellipse according to national standard or SAE standard, choosing of described standard should be corresponding with designing the manikin adopted;
(3) prepare to check needed for periphery digital-to-analogue, comprise instrument carrier panel, door internal decoration plate, vertical column internal decoration plate, glass for vehicle window the automobile main cabin that makes become all of enclosure space, and steering handwheel, seat is at the interior major part in this enclosure space;
(4) Driver's eyellipse is considered as incident light source, gets eyellipse and take up an official post an eyespot as point source of light, make incident ray directive DVD screen surface, ask and make its reflected light rays, on directive screen, the reflected light rays of each point surrounds a reflector space; The union of the reflector space of all eyespots, forms the light beam of Driver's eyellipse light beam after DVD screen reflection;
(5) region of folded light beam directive is investigated, if folded light beam is all blocked by car inner component, not by outside the directive car of glass for vehicle window clear area, according to light path principle of reversibility, illustrate that extraneous high light cannot by glass for vehicle window clear area direct directive DVD screen, DVD screen can not produce dazzling;
(6) region of folded light beam directive is investigated, if folded light beam partially or completely through outside the directive car of glass for vehicle window clear area, according to light path principle of reversibility, then extraneous high light can pass through glass for vehicle window clear area direct directive DVD screen, corresponding reflected light rays must enter Driver's eyellipse, and DVD screen produces dazzling; On this basis, analyze dazzling issuable harm size, corresponding adjustment is made to the layout of DVD screen.
Advantageous Effects of the present invention is:
The present invention utilizes the light path principle of reversibility of geometric optics, using the set of Driver's eyellipse as numerous points light source, these light source directives DVD screen forms folded light beam after reflection, investigate the region of folded light beam directive, if reflected beam part or all by outside the directive car of glass for vehicle window clear area, then think that DVD screen can produce dazzling; Otherwise, then think and can not produce dazzling, thus complete the anti-glare check of DVD screen.The present invention is simple, effectively, check data are more complete, checks conclusion and has more confidence level, be applicable to large-scale promotion application.
